Automatic Twitch live stream alerts
Kyro helps Twitch communities announce live streams automatically. Connect a Twitch creator, choose a Discord announcement channel, and notify members whenever the stream goes live.

Easy setup
Invite Kyro and select the server you want to configure.
Choose your server and open the relevant feature settings.
Select channels, roles, messages, permissions, and automation options.
Save your settings and start using the feature in your Discord community.
